nickn2...Many were made,,,but getting them to the soldiers was another issue.. Some say there were never any issued and some say they were issued but limited.. It could be like some of the other units,,,that is some were issued for the propaganda effect and just issued for photo taking sessions and that's it.. There is also cufftitles made and issued..

Surprisingly,being that the unit is late and very few and even less issued to wear they aren't worth mega money.. There are 100s of these in collections / circulation from the Dachau depot hoard.. It's a good find ,,sometimes you can get these for $200!
